Blackberry Thunder-The Hotness

I came into work this morning and I saw some newer and clearer pictures of the Blackberry Thunder. We originally posted this article when there was early whispers and some speculation of this device. Here we are a few weeks later and this new phone is looking awesome. I have heard this will be a Verizon exclusive device using both CDMA and GSM technologies to make it a World Phone.

Now one of the really cool things it is rumored it will have a glass screen. This may not sound like much, but when you see it on a phone it looks extremely classy. It is a really great looking phone and Research In Motion makes a fantastic product. There are other great manufacturers out there, but I would have to say RIM is the most consistent.

Now the pictures that have been leaked are of the Media Player and it looks crazy awesome! It looks to have a very clean interface and the icons remind me of the Blackberry Bold’s icons. Of course it looks like you could turn it sideways to take advantage of the 360×480 widescreen to watch videos. We will have to keep an eye out for this device. We hear iPhone Killer almost daily now with new touchscreen phones becoming a dime a dozen, but RIM does not disappoint and I predict this will be the new Gold Standard for Consumer and Business TouchScreen devices.

What Carrier should I use?

Easy question, easy answer; you should use the carrier that is best for you. Now for some people that do not live in big cities like New York and Houston, your choice may have to be based on your coverage area. You could find coverage maps for Sprint, T-Mobile, ATT, Helio, and Verizon on their websites. We want you to sign up with a carrier that provides you with the great coverage you deserve.

Now for those of us that have more than one choice it starts coming down to pricing and features that work for us. When you look at the hour evening calling starts Sprint has the best option at 7:oo P.M. with most plans and gives an option to start at 6:oo P.M. If you are looking to use a lot of data either with your phone or an aircard Sprint and Verizon are my recommendations. They have a fast and reliable broadband network. ATT/Cingular is a good choice for some customers that go to rural areas often due to their wide roaming agreement they have with smaller GSM carriers. I think T-Mobile has the best pricing. Now Helio is a really cool carrier with great applications for MySpace and Youtube built into their phones. They have really awesome phones for the younger market.

So features and pricing is one facet to look at, another is what phones does the carrier have that would be good for you? We have business customers that need their Blackberry, and we have our average customers that just need a phone to make and receive calls. Whether you prefer a touchscreen or a full QWERTY keyboard most carriers can suit your needs. As always before any purchases there are a few things to consider.
